What is Local SEO?
Local SEO means making your website easy to find for people near you. When someone searches for a product or service in your city, local SEO helps your business show up in search results. For example, if you have a bakery in "Your City," you want to appear when people search "bakery in Your City."

Start with a Strong Google Business Profile
Your Google Business Profile (formerly Google My Business) is a free tool. It shows your business on Google Search and Maps. Here are easy steps to set it up:
Go to Google Business.
Create or claim your business listing.
Fill in your business name, address, and phone number correctly.
Add your business hours and website link.
Upload clear photos of your shop or products.
This profile helps people see your business location, hours, and reviews. Make sure information is correct and up to date.
Use Local Keywords on Your Website
Keywords are words people type into search engines. Use words that match what customers search for in your city. For example:
"Coffee shop in Your City"
"Affordable haircuts near me"
"Best pizza delivery Your City"
Place these keywords in important places:
Page titles
Headings
Website text
Image descriptions
Keep the words natural. Don't add too many keywords. Write for people first.

Add Your Business Address on Every Page
Include your address and phone number on every page of your site. Usually, this goes in the footer area. Why? Because it tells search engines where you are. It also helps customers contact you easily.
Get Reviews from Local Customers
Reviews build trust. They show your business is real and good. Ask happy customers to leave reviews on Google or other sites like Yelp or Facebook. Here are tips:
Send a thank you message after a sale.
Politely ask for a review.
Make it easy by sending a direct link.
Respond to reviews, both good and bad.
More positive reviews help your business stand out in local search.
Use Local Links to Boost Your Site
Links from other local websites help your SEO. They show search engines that your business is part of the community. Here are some ways to get local links:
Partner with other local businesses.
Join local business groups or chambers of commerce.
Write guest posts for local blogs or news sites.
Sponsor local events or charities and ask for a link.
Keep Your Business Information Consistent Everywhere
It is important that your name, address, and phone number (NAP) are the same on all websites. This includes:
Your website
Google Business Profile
Social media pages
Local directories
Inconsistent information confuses search engines and customers. Check and fix any differences you find.
Create Local Content for Your Audience
Write articles or blog posts about topics related to your city or niche. For example, if you own a pet store, write about:
Best dog parks in Your City
Tips for pet care during local weather
Local pet adoption events
This type of content attracts local visitors and helps your SEO.

Monitor Your Local SEO Progress
Keep track of your website visitors and search rankings. Use free tools like Google Analytics and Google Search Console. Check how many people find your site and which keywords they use. Adjust your SEO efforts based on this data.
